Lead by the Spirit or Driven by the Letter

The Holy Ghost was given on the day of Pentecost (Acts 2). Jesus said that When He (the Holy Ghost) comes, He shall teach you all things, & bring all things to your remembrance, whatsoever I have said unto you (John 14:26).

It (He) is the spirit of God that leads and guides us as believers because His Spirit (God) dwells on the inside of us, God will speak to us through His written Word, the Preacher, Teacher or any way God desires (He is Sovereign) but what ever God has to say, through whom ever He chooses, it will always line up with what is written in scripture! And His Spirit (the Holy Ghost that dwells inside you) will either confirm His Word or Alert you as to what He did or did not say in His Word.This is why it is important to Study! (2 Tim 2:15). David said “thy word have I hid in my heart, that I might not sin against thee” (Psalms 119:11).

It has been my observation that believers are being driven by fear when it comes to serving God; their relationship with God is based on Tradition and a set of (dos and Don’t). If they consistently follow these rules (most of which are not in the word of God) they feel this is Holy Living and God is pleased when in fact it is self-righteousness.

If strict obedience to Leaders, rules, traditions and tales (not based on Gods Word) are your source and guide for living right (holiness), you are driven by the letter and not lead by the Spirit of God.

“For all who are lead by the Spirit of God, these are sons of God” (Rom.8: 14).
